Abstract

The utility model discloses an automatic screw striking machine and aims at providing the automatic screw striking machine which can correct positions of products automatically, improves production efficiency, and lowers production cost. Moreover, the produced products are good in uniformity and high in quality. The automatic screw striking machine comprises an installation plate (1) and an electric control system. A motor (2), a divider (3), a rotating plate (4), a screw gun (5) and a feeding mechanism are arranged on the installation plate (1). A plurality of clamps (6) used for locating the products are arranged on the rotating plate (4). The screw gun (5) and the feeding mechanism are connected through a feeding pipe. The automatic screw striking machine further comprises a screw gun moving mechanism and a correcting mechanism, wherein the screw gun moving mechanism and the correcting mechanism are arranged on the installation plate (1). The screw gun (5) is arranged on the screw gun moving mechanism and located above the rotating plate (4). The correcting mechanism is arranged above the rotating plate (4). The automatic screw striking machine can be widely applied to the screw striking assembly field.

Description

Automatic screw fixing machine
Technical field
The utility model relates to a kind of automatic screw fixing machine.
Background technology
In the assembling process of electronics, automobile, household appliances, engineering goods, digital product, toy etc. industry-by-industry, adopting screw to connect is modal means.Therefore cross in kind in the assembling of these products, stubborn screw just becomes the most basic a kind of operation.Adopt hand screwdriver to twist screw in traditional assembly technology product is assembled, this original manual manipulation mode needs more assembly crewman, and its efficient is low, the operation that yields poorly is inconsistent, and product quality can not be guaranteed.Along with the progress of the development of society and science and technology, people's utility model adapt to and produce in enormous quantities and the electric screw driver of mechanized operation.Appearing as of this electric screw driver enhanced productivity, and reduces labour intensity and played positive effect.Yet, still need with manually coordinating the crawl screw with this electric screw driver, and proofread and correct and put in screwed hole, re-use electric screw driver and tighten.This mode is tightened with respect to manual screwdriver and has been improved efficient, but along with the paces of modernization construction are accelerated, the level of people's lives improves, demand to various products such as electronics, household electrical appliances, automobile, toys is also increasing, the technological innovation that all kinds of automated production patterns and assembling line etc. are a large amount of.Existing hand screwdriver is tightened or electronic screwdriver tightening way can not adapt to the demand of mechanization and automatic mass production.
Publication number is that 101879710A discloses a kind of automatic screw fixing machine, comprise support, be designed with motor and dispenser in support, be designed with a rotating disk on support, the driven by motor dispenser, dispenser drives rotating disk, also comprise electric control box, touch-screen, feed mechanism, mechanism and material testing machine structure screw, electric control box and support design are together, touch-screen, feed mechanism, screw mechanism and material testing machine structure respectively around the rotating disk design on support, touch-screen, feed mechanism, screw mechanism and material testing machine structure are electrically connected respectively electric control box.The original manual or electric screw driver of contrast, this automatic screw fixing machine can be realized the large-scale production of mechanization and automation, yet in use we find, mechanism can only do mechanical type and moves up and down because screw, and can not do the translational motion of other positions, mechanism can only be to the processing that screws of an assigned address on a certain rotational workpieces position of rotating disk therefore screw, if the many places processing that need to screw is arranged a rotational workpieces position, just needing that a plurality of mechanisms that screw are installed could realize, but corresponding production cost just increases substantially.In addition; therefore this automatic screw fixing machine requires highly to product set, usually can affect the quality that screws because product does not place in process, and homogeneity of product is difficult to reach requirement; also may damage product or machine when serious, also can cause the raising of production cost.Therefore each manufacturer wishes to have a kind of automaticity high, can enhance productivity energetically again and the screw fixing machine of the quality that guarantees to screw satisfies the needs of current mechanization and automatic mass production.

The specific embodiment
as Fig. 1, Fig. 2, Fig. 3, shown in Figure 4, the utility model discloses a kind of automatic screw fixing machine, comprise installing plate 1 and electric control system, described installing plate 1 is processed into by iron plate, described electric control system comprises the PLC controller, operating platform 18, display 19, described operating platform 18 and display 19 all are electrically connected to described PLC controller, the programmed instruction that in the time of can being written in work by described PLC controller, screw fixing machine will be used, these programmed instruction are used for controlling the concrete running of screw fixing machine various piece, can carry out concrete operations on described operating platform 18, and the running status of screw fixing machine can show at described display 19, facilitate the staff to observe.described installing plate 1 is provided with motor 2, dispenser 3, rotating disk 4, screw gun 5 and feed mechanism, described motor 2 is electrically connected to described electric control system, the rotation of described motor 2 makes described dispenser 3 rotations, described dispenser 3 drives again described rotating disk 4 and rotates, be provided with a plurality of fixtures 6 at described rotating disk 4, product to be assembled is positioned by described fixture 6 and is fixed on described rotating disk 4, described feed mechanism is used for placing screw to be assembled and is connected with described screw gun 5 pipelines by feed pipe 17, during work, screw is transported to the interior assigned address of described screw gun 5 by described feed pipe 17.Described automatic screw fixing machine also comprises screw gun travel mechanism and the aligning gear that is arranged on described installing plate 1, and described screw gun 5 is arranged in described screw gun travel mechanism and is positioned at the top of described rotating disk 4.Set the mobile process instruction on described PLC controller, described screw gun travel mechanism moves to described screw gun 5 according to these mobile process instructions the assigned address that will process or assemble.Described aligning gear also is positioned at the top of described rotating disk 4, and described aligning gear is used for proofreading and correct the screw hole position of product and the relative position of described rotating disk 4.In actual applications, rotate to the frock position of one of them fixture when described rotating disk 4, if this frock position is positioned at the below of described screw gun 5, can make the frock position of next fixture just be positioned at the below of described aligning gear.Therefore, when the product in the fixture of 5 pairs one of described screw gun frock position assembled, described aligning gear was proofreaied and correct the product in the fixture of next frock position simultaneously, loops thus, makes the homogeneity of product that assembles higher, and quality is good.
Described screw gun travel mechanism comprises X-axis mobile platform, y-axis shift moving platform, Z axis mobile platform, described X-axis mobile platform is arranged on also can be along the Y direction back and forth movement on described y-axis shift moving platform, described Z axis mobile platform is arranged on also can be along the X-direction back and forth movement on described X-axis mobile platform, and described screw gun 5 is arranged on described Z axis mobile platform.Particularly, described y-axis shift moving platform comprises guide rail I 23, slide plate I 24, stepper motor I 25 and ball-screw I 26, described guide rail I 23 is fixedly connected on described installing plate 1, described slide plate I 24 is slidably connected with described guide rail I 23, described stepper motor I 25 drives an end of described ball screw I 26, the other end of described ball screw I 26 is fixedly connected with described slide plate I 24, realizes thus the motion of described screw gun 5 on Y direction.Described X-axis mobile platform comprises guide rail II 27, slide plate II 28, stepper motor II 29 and ball-screw II 30, described guide rail II 27 is fixedly connected with described slide plate I 24, stepper motor II 29 drives an end of described ball-screw II 30, the other end of described ball-screw II 30 is fixedly connected with described slide plate II 28, realizes thus the motion of described screw gun 5 on X-direction.Described Z axis mobile platform comprises fixed head 31, and described fixed head 31 is fixedly connected with described slide plate II 28, and described screw gun 5 is fixedly installed on described fixed head 31, and described screw gun 5 rifle heads own just can be realized the motion on Z-direction.Under the control of corresponding program instruction, finally can make described screw gun 5 realize exactly the motion of above-mentioned X-axis, Y-axis and Z-direction, arrive assigned address.Therefore, under the acting in conjunction of described X-axis mobile platform, described y-axis shift moving platform and described Z axis mobile platform, the optional position that described screw gun 5 can arrive described rotating disk 4 tops processes, particularly can satisfy on a rotary work station of described rotating disk 4, assemble a plurality of positions to identical product, greatly enhances productivity.
Described screw gun is prior art, it comprises the rifle body, be provided with displacement transducer, torsion torque sensor, screwdriver, screwdriver, servomotor I and servomotor II in described rifle body, described displacement transducer, described torsion torque sensor, described servomotor I and institute's servomotor II are electrically connected to described electric control system respectively, described servomotor I is controlled described screwdriver and is moved up and down, described screwdriver is connected with the output shaft rotation of described servomotor II, can realize the action that screws.During work, screw enters in described rifle body, and described screwdriver vacuum holds screw, and described servomotor I is controlled described screwdriver vertically downward, and after touching product, described servomotor II is rotated with described screwdriver and begun the work of screwing.The displacement of the described screwdriver motion of described displacement transducer feedback and the depth data that screws, described torsion torque sensor feedback torque data prevent excessive because of the degree of depth that screws or the excessive waste product of producing of torsion, improve the quality of products.
The slide block that described aligning gear comprises bracing frame, proofread and correct pin and can move up and down along support frame as described above, described correction pin is arranged on described slide block and is positioned at the top of described rotating disk 4, and described correction pin is used for proofreading and correct the screw hole position of product and the relative position of described rotating disk 4.Can use the described slide block movement of motor-driven particularly, this motor is electrically connected to described electric control system, controls thus the motion of described slide block by corresponding programmed instruction, and then drives described correction pin and move up and down, and realizes correction work.In the utility model, due to described aligning gear having been arranged, people only need be placed on product on described fixture, do not need manual synchronizing, have greatly saved manpower and materials, and efficient and the precision of proofreading and correct also be greatly enhanced, the high conformity of assembled product.
Described installing plate 1 is provided with support 11, described support 11 is provided with the sensor 12 that is electrically connected to described electric control system, described sensor 12 is positioned at the top of described rotating disk 4, described sensor 12 is used for judging product on rotating disk described in assembling process 4 or the position of fixture, also can judge has product-free or fixture, and information is fed back to described electric control system.If determine one of them frock position product-free or fixture of described rotating disk 4, when 4 rotations of described rotating disk during to this frock position, programmed instruction is controlled described screw gun 5 and is failure to actuate, and can effectively avoid so described screw gun 5 cause the screw waste or damage the problems such as described rotating disk 4 and described fixture 6 because of do-nothing operation.
The screw dish that described feed mechanism comprises material table 17 and is arranged on helical structure on described material table 17, described screw tray bottom is provided with for the electromagnet and the spring leaf that cause vibration, the junction of described screw dish and described feed pipe 7 is provided with screw guide road, described screw guide road only allows screw to pass through in a certain placement state (such as upright or handstand), then enters in the described feed pipe 7 described screw guns 5 of arrival.During work, under the acting in conjunction of electromagnet and spring leaf, described screw hair updo goes out dither and arranging screws is become the shape of rule, along spiral wall toward the road conveying of described screw guide, when arriving described screw guide road, the screw that meets placement state enters described screw guide road, then flows into that described feed pipe 7 is last to be arrived in screw gun, incongruently fall back to again described screw tray bottom, circulation thus.
In order to make overall structure of the present utility model compacter, described automatic screw fixing machine also comprises frame 20, wherein, described electric control system, described installing plate are arranged on respectively top, the middle part of described frame 20, the bottom of described frame is provided with functional compartment 21, and described functional compartment can as the distribution box of machine, can also be used as the tool box, the sidepiece of described frame is provided with waste material box 22, is convenient in process certified products and waste material are separated.
to sum up, workflow of the present utility model is: according to the assembly path of product, write required programmed instruction on described PLC controller, screw is put into described screw dish and opened vibration, screw is screened arrangement, after screw enters described screw gun and held by screwdriver, ready, product to be assembled is fixed on described fixture 6, start screw fixing machine, this moment, corresponding programmed instruction made described motor 2 work, and then described rotating disk 4 is rotated, effect due to described dispenser 3, described rotating disk 4 stops after turning to the angle of setting, the position that this moment, described rotating disk 4 stopped is just one of them frock position, described aligning gear below just in time has a fixture and clamping product, under the control of corresponding programmed instruction, described aligning gear is precisely proofreaied and correct this product, the below product-free of described screw gun 5 under current position of rotation detected due to described sensor, therefore described screw gun 5 is failure to actuate, after correction is completed, described rotating disk 4 continues to rotate to next frock position, the frock position that be corrected this moment just is positioned at the below of described screw gun 5, corresponding programmed instruction assembles fast by a plurality of positions that described screw gun mobile platform drives 5 pairs of identical products of described screw gun, meanwhile, described aligning gear is proofreaied and correct fixture and the product of its below, for next step assembling is prepared, after assembling was completed, described rotating disk 4 continued to rotate to next assembly station, when described screw gun 5 carries out assembly work, takes off the product of completing assembling and reapposes product to be assembled, cycle operation thus.
